N2 - We report a high-efficiency source of cross-polarized photon pairs via type-II quasi-phase matched spontaneous parametric down-conversion using periodically poled lithium niobate (PPLN). The photon pairs are generated from the PPLN in a fifth-order quasi-phase matching condition around 800 nm, which matches the wavelength band of efficient Si avalanche photo-diodes. We obtained the photon-pair production rate of 6.8 × 105 s-1 mW-1.
